ID: ENSBTAT00000131175
Gene: ENSBTAG00000003547 cleavage stimulation factor subunit 2 [Source:VGNC Symbol;Acc:VGNC:27781]
Polypeptide: ENSBTAT00000131175
X:51349644..51381374 -1